首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

运行脚本后未将数据写入csv文件

运行脚本后未将数据写入CSV文件可能是由于以下几个原因导致的:

  1. 脚本中的代码逻辑错误:请检查脚本中是否正确地打开了CSV文件,并在适当的位置使用写入操作将数据写入文件。确保代码中没有语法错误或逻辑错误。
  2. 文件路径错误:请确保脚本中指定的CSV文件路径是正确的。可以使用绝对路径或相对路径来指定文件路径,确保脚本能够找到文件并进行写入操作。
  3. 文件权限问题:请确保脚本运行的用户具有足够的权限来写入文件。如果脚本运行的用户没有写入文件的权限,可以尝试更改文件的权限或将文件保存到具有写入权限的目录中。
  4. 数据未正确处理:请确保脚本中的数据已经正确处理并准备好写入CSV文件。可以使用调试工具或打印语句来检查数据是否正确。

如果以上方法都没有解决问题,可以尝试以下步骤:

  1. 检查CSV文件是否已经存在:如果CSV文件已经存在,并且脚本中没有指定以追加模式打开文件,那么数据将无法写入文件。可以尝试删除或重命名已存在的文件,然后重新运行脚本。
  2. 检查CSV文件是否被其他程序占用:如果CSV文件正在被其他程序占用,例如Excel等,那么脚本将无法写入文件。可以尝试关闭其他程序,或将文件复制到另一个位置进行写入操作。
  3. 检查脚本中的错误处理机制:如果脚本中存在错误处理机制,例如异常捕获,可以检查是否有相关的错误信息或日志记录。这些信息可能有助于确定问题所在。

总结起来,解决运行脚本后未将数据写入CSV文件的问题,需要仔细检查代码逻辑、文件路径、文件权限以及数据处理等方面的问题。确保代码正确地打开了CSV文件,并使用写入操作将数据写入文件。如果问题仍然存在,可以尝试检查CSV文件是否已经存在、是否被其他程序占用,以及脚本中的错误处理机制。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券